【产品名称】
手动部署 Oceanbase 社区版
【产品版本】
oceanbase-ce-3.1.1-4.el7.x86_64.rpm
【问题描述】
在进行创建目录和建立链接时 使用的是 admin 用户 提示
mkdir: 无法创建目录"/home/admin/oceanbase/store/obcluster": 权限不够
【产品名称】
手动部署 Oceanbase 社区版
【产品版本】
oceanbase-ce-3.1.1-4.el7.x86_64.rpm
【问题描述】
在进行创建目录和建立链接时 使用的是 admin 用户 提示
mkdir: 无法创建目录"/home/admin/oceanbase/store/obcluster": 权限不够
这个是主机用户没有操作权限把,可以看看/home/admin和/home/admin/oceanbase这个目录的权限和属主是什么
ll /home|grep admin
ll /home/admin|grep oceanbase
看报错是没权限
在进行创建目录和建立链接时 使用的是 admin 用户 提示mkdir: 无法创建目录"/home/admin/oceanbase/store/obcluster": 权限不够
这个你可以不用su - admin 用户下创建目录,你可以直接在root用户下创建好目录后,将目录的权限用户和组设置成admin;例如:
mkdir -p /data/observer01/store/{sort_dir,sstable,clog,ilog,slog}(创建observer所需要的目录)
chown -R admin:admin /data/(将data文件夹的所属用户和组修改为admin)